PM pays tribute to Bangabandhu

Sun News Desk: Prime Minister and Awami League President Sheikh Hasina and her younger sister Sheikh Rehana paid tribute on Friday at Bangabandhu's tomb in Tungipara of Gopalganj.

They laid wreaths at the tomb of the father of nation. Later, she participated in special prayers and prayers for the souls of the martyrs of August 15. At this time, a team of armed forces gave a guard of honor to the Prime Minister.

Earlier on Friday, Prime Minister started her journey with a convoy from Gana Bhavan. Later, they crossed the Padma Bridge and halted at Service Area-2. Bangabandhu's two daughters reached Tungipara at 10am in the morning.

The Prime Minister is supposed to welcome Abdul Hamid in the afternoon. After that, the Prime Minister will leave for Dhaka from Tungipara.
